Program Curriculum
Course Structure
- Classroom Literacy Instruction
- Instructional Environments and Practicies for Students with Disabilities
- Developing Reading Comprehension and Content Knowledge for Students with Disabilities
- Math and Inquiry Instruction for Students with Disabilities
- Managing School and Classroom-wide Student Behavior to Promote Efficient and Effective Instruction
- Teaching Students with Severe and Multiple Disabilities
- Assessment of Students with Disabilities
- Teaching Written Expression to Students with Disabilities
- Educating Students with Emotional Disorders and Challenging Behaviors:Advanced Tiers of Support
- Clinical Internship: Teaching Students with Disabilities
- Clinical Intenship: Teaching Students with Emotional and Behavioral Disorders (for a total of 6)
- Clinical Internship Seminar: Teaching Students with Disabilities (2)

Admission requirements
- Successfully complete a bachelors degree from an accredited institution with at least a 3.0 gpa.
- Meet the Certification Eligibility requirements for your chosen program.
- Submit three satisfactory references (one of these must address the candidate\'s academic abilities and/or potential for graduate study; one must attest to the candidate\'s teaching abilities and/or potential; the third may attest to either academic or teaching abilities/potential, or to other aspects of the candidate\'s experiences or traits that are felt to enhance the application).
- Complete all questions on the application and take your time with the written questions. We read your responses carefully, not only for what you say but also to learn how you express your thoughts in writing. Be candid about your goals, experiences, and your own literacy abilities.
